Wasp extermination services involve identifying and safely removing wasp nests from residential or commercial properties. Trained service providers use specialized equipment and methods to eliminate wasp colonies, ensuring that the nests are thoroughly removed and the insects are kept at bay. This process often includes inspecting the property for active nests, applying targeted treatments, and advising on measures to prevent future infestations. The goal is to create a safer environment by reducing the presence of wasps, which can pose risks due to their stings and aggressive behavior.

These services are particularly helpful for addressing problems caused by wasp activity, such as frequent stinging incidents, nests built in inconvenient or dangerous locations, and the presence of large colonies that threaten the safety of residents or visitors. Wasps tend to build nests in sheltered areas like eaves, attics, sheds, or ground burrows, especially during warmer months. When wasps become a nuisance or a safety concern, professional extermination can effectively remove the threat, allowing property owners to enjoy their outdoor spaces without worry.

The overview below groups typical Wasp Extermination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Wasp Removal - Typical costs for simple wasp removal services range from $250 to $600 for many smaller jobs, such as removing nests from eaves or shrubs. Many routine projects fall within this middle range, with fewer jobs reaching the higher end.

Wasp Nest Removal - Removing a single, accessible nest usually costs between $300 and $700, depending on the nest's size and location. Larger or more difficult nests can push costs upward, but most projects stay within this range.

Full Wasp Extermination - Complete extermination of a wasp infestation in a property typically ranges from $500 to $1,200. Larger or multiple nests may increase costs, but many projects are completed within this band.

Wasp Prevention Services - Ongoing prevention or sealing of entry points often costs between $400 and $900, with many service providers offering packages that fall into this typical range. Fewer projects extend beyond the higher end of this spectrum.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of wasp infestations? Signs include visible wasp nests, increased wasp activity around the property, and wasps repeatedly returning to a specific area.

How do local contractors typically handle wasp extermination? They assess the nest location, use targeted removal methods, and ensure the nest is safely eliminated to prevent future issues.

Are there any safety precautions to consider during wasp removal? It’s recommended to keep a safe distance from nests and allow professional contractors to handle the removal to avoid stings or accidents.

What types of wasp species do extermination services usually address? They commonly handle paper wasps, yellowjackets, and hornets, which are the most prevalent in residential areas.

How can I prevent future wasp problems? Regular inspections, sealing potential nesting sites, and removing food sources can help reduce the likelihood of wasp infestations.
